> Individual Boost headers (I checked format.hpp and shared_ptr.hpp)
> seem to expand to about 300 sub-headers a pop, with not much overlap.

Are there still objections against including those remaining headers in
the monotone source? This has two advantages:

1) The trouble of users with external boost libary versions goes away

2) We're in control of what boost version we're using and can remove
more and more of its actual dependencies from the monotone core.
